Vitamin E Oil (DL-α-Tocopheryl Acetate) is a highly stable, synthetic form of Vitamin E widely celebrated in the cosmetic industry for its excellent skin-conditioning and antioxidant properties. Unlike pure tocopherol, the acetate form is highly resistant to oxidation when exposed to air, light, and heat, ensuring a significantly longer shelf life for both the raw ingredient and your finished formulations.
This deeply nourishing, viscous oil acts as a powerful humectant and emollient. It helps protect the skin barrier, improve moisture retention, and soothe dry or irritated skin. It is a staple additive for anti-aging skin care, lip care, hair treatments, and daily moisturizing formulas.

TECHNICAL SPECIFICATIONS:
INCI Name: Tocopheryl Acetate
Chemical Name: DL-α-tocopherol acetate (Synthetic Vitamin E Acetate)
CAS Number: 7695-91-2 (Alternative: 58-95-7)
EC / EINECS Number: 231-710-0 (Synthesized specifically as the stable, esterified alpha-tocopheryl acetate form)
Purity / Activity: Typically ≥98% pure,
Biological Activity: 1,000 IU per gram (or 1 IU per milligram). Supplying approximately 1,000 IU of Vitamin E biological activity per 1 gram.
Appearance (@ 25°C): Clear, colorless to yellowish, highly viscous oily liquid
Odor: Practically odorless to very faint, characteristic odor
Stability: Highly stable against light, heat, and air. Unlike unesterified Vitamin E (Tocopherol), which oxidizes rapidly in the bottle, the acetate ester group preserves its shelf life.
SOLUBILITY & COMPATIBILITY:
Solubility: Practically insoluble in water. Freely soluble in acetone, chloroform, anhydrous ethanol, and fatty/vegetable oils.
Compatibility: Highly compatible with lipophilic (oil-soluble) systems, cosmetic bases, essential oils, and carrier oils.

RECOMMENDED USAGE PERCENTAGES:
Typically used between 0.5% to 5.0% in cosmetic formulations.
Creams, Lotions, & Daily Moisturizers: 0.5% – 2%
Lip Balms, Salves, & Heavy Body Butters: 1% – 5%
Anti-Aging Serums & Targeted Treatment Oils: 1% – 5%
As a Formula Stabilizer / Antioxidant: 0.2% – 1% (to protect fragile carrier oils)
NOTE: (Skin Antioxidant Action) - While it provides excellent antioxidant, barrier-strengthening, and soothing properties for the user's skin, it does not act as a primary batch antioxidant to prevent your bottled base oils from going rancid. (For batch preservation against oil rancidity, unesterified DL-alpha-tocopherol or Mixed Tocopherols are preferred).
FORMULATION & BLENDING GUIDE:
Oil-Phase Addition: Vitamin E Acetate is entirely oil-soluble. In hot-process emulsions (like creams and lotions), it should ideally be added during the cool-down phase (below 40°C / 104°F) alongside your preservatives and fragrances to preserve its structural integrity, though it can survive brief heating phases.
Viscosity Tips: Raw Vitamin E Acetate is a very thick, sticky liquid at room temperature. For easier pouring and measuring, gently warm the container in a warm water bath prior to formulation.
Storage: Store in a tightly sealed container in a cool, well-ventilated environment away from direct sunlight. While highly stable against oxidation, maintaining cool storage prevents structural degradation over extended periods.

Tocopheryl Acetate versus Pure Tocopherol
The key difference between Tocopheryl Acetate and pure Tocopherol is that Acetate is an ester designed for stable skin absorption and barrier conditioning, while pure Tocopherol acts as a direct antioxidant that protects your product formulations from going rancid on the shelf.
Feature | Tocopheryl Acetate (Vitamin E Acetate) | Pure Tocopherol (Mixed / d-Alpha Tocopherol) |
Chemical Form | Esterified (stable, bound molecule) | Unesterified (free, active hydroxyl group) |
Primary Function | Skin conditioning and nourishment | Formula antioxidant and oil preservative |
Oxidation Stability | High stability against air, light, and heat | Prone to oxidation and degradation over time |
Skin Action | Converts to free tocopherol inside the skin | Active antioxidant immediately upon contact |
Best Used For | Skin care lotions, creams, and body oils | Protecting carrier oils and bases from rancidity |
